San Francisco begins registering non-citizens, and illegal immigrants to vote
July 19, 2018 KUSI Newsroom
SAN FRANCISCO (KUSI) – The Sacramento Bee is reporting that illegal immigrants and non-citizens have began registering to vote for a election happening this November.
This makes San Francisco the first California city to allow illegal immigrants, and non-citizens voting rights in local elections.
Hillary Ronen, a San Francisco supervisor, told the San Francisco Chronicle, “This is no-brainer legislation,”
